Imaging Modalities

Imaging modalities, akin to computed tomography (CT) scans, magnetic resonance imaging (MRI), and ultrasound, play an important position in detecting blood clots. These assessments use numerous types of vitality, akin to X-rays or magnetic fields, to create detailed photographs of the physique’s inner buildings. Within the case of blood clots, these photographs may help establish the placement, measurement, and kind of clot.

  • CT scans use X-rays to supply cross-sectional photographs of the physique, which may help establish blood clots within the lungs, mind, and different organs.

  • MRI makes use of magnetic fields and radio waves to supply detailed photographs of the physique’s inner buildings, which may help establish blood clots within the mind and spinal wire.

  • Ultrasound makes use of high-frequency sound waves to supply photographs of the physique’s inner buildings, which may help establish blood clots within the legs and arms.

Laboratory Assessments

Laboratory assessments are one other essential instrument in detecting blood clots. These assessments analyze blood samples to establish potential clotting issues or abnormalities. In some circumstances, these assessments can detect the presence of blood clots themselves, permitting for early analysis and therapy.

  • Coagulation assessments, such because the prothrombin time (PT) and activated partial thromboplastin time (aPTT) assessments, analyze blood samples to detect potential clotting issues.

The Prognosis of Blood Clots: A Multifaceted Course of

Diagnosing blood clots is a posh job that requires a complete strategy, involving a number of assessments, examinations, and evaluations. On this part, we are going to delve into the diagnostic protocols and procedures utilized in each main and secondary care settings to establish and ensure blood clot formations.The analysis of blood clots usually begins with a radical affected person historical past and bodily examination.

  • Medical professionals use a mix of scientific signs, medical historical past, and bodily examination findings to suspect blood clots.
  • Affected person historical past performs a vital position in figuring out threat components, akin to latest surgical procedure, long-distance journey, or household historical past of blood clots.
  • Bodily examination can reveal indicators of blood clots, together with swelling, ache, or discoloration of the affected space.
  • The historical past and bodily examination findings are essential in guiding additional diagnostic testing.

In secondary care settings, extra superior diagnostic assessments are employed to verify the presence of blood clots. These assessments embody:

  • Imaging research, akin to computed tomography (CT) scans, magnetic resonance imaging (MRI), or ultrasound, to visualise blood clots in arteries or veins.
  • Lab assessments, together with full blood depend (CBC), blood assessments for coagulation components, and D-dimer ranges, to evaluate clotting time and potential contributing components.
  • Echocardiogram or Doppler ultrasound to judge blood movement and detect potential clot formations within the coronary heart or lungs.

FAQs: How Do You Know If You Have A Blood Clot

What’s the most typical kind of blood clot?

Deep vein thrombosis (DVT) is the most typical kind of blood clot, affecting the deep veins within the legs or arms.

Can blood clots be prevented?

Sure, blood clots may be prevented via a mix of life-style modifications, akin to common train and sustaining a wholesome weight, and medical interventions, akin to compression stockings and anticoagulant medicines.

How lengthy does it take to get better from a blood clot?

The restoration time for a blood clot can range relying on the placement and severity of the clot. Nevertheless, with correct therapy, most individuals can get better totally inside a couple of months.
